Nokia Customer service sucks....or "why my next phone will be running Android"
 
I contacted Nokia customer service with a technical problem that is a software issue. My N900 stopped broadcasting the media player over the FM transmitter. Other applications would broadcast over the FM transmitter, so it is not a hardware problem. Anyhow, I contacted Nokia customer service back in April and received this automated reply on Friday April 2, 2010:

Then I heard nothing from them. Nothing, that is, until Friday July 30, 2010. Here is the message:

Great, I thought. Now I can get some help. I replied that my problem was still unresolved and I still would appreciate help. Here is the reply I got yesterday, August 5, 2010:

What in the hell does that mean? "Please check if it is properly setup"? Absolutely useless. I was hoping that someone who actually knows something about Maemo would suggest something to try that does not involve reinstalling the operating system.

Four months after my inquiry, I get a standard reply, with no actual information on how to "check if it is properly setup" or "reupdate the software."

Nokia: you have just lost a customer.

I think they wanted you to try reinstalling the mediaplayer. If you have some programs from extras-devel.. they maight have caused the problem with the mediaplayer. Make sure to purge it when uninstalling.

Open terminal as root:
1. dpkg -P mediaplayer
2. apt-get update
3. apt-get install mediaplayer
